THE ULTIMATE INTERNET SERVICES HANDBOOK: EVERYTHING YOU REQUIRED TO KNOW

The Ultimate Internet Services Handbook: Everything You Required To Know

The Ultimate Internet Services Handbook: Everything You Required To Know

Blog Article

Writer-Ottesen Shaffer

Discover the best Internet Services Manual for all your requirements. Check out interaction protocols, core principles of SOAP and REST, and finest methods for smooth application. Uncover the keys to grasping internet services, from recognizing the basics to implementing scalable design. Master the art of designing secure systems and optimizing for future development. Unlock the power of internet solutions at your fingertips.

Overview of Internet Providers



If you have actually ever before questioned what web services are and exactly how they function, this review is the excellent location to start. Internet services are a means for different applications to interact with each other over the internet. They allow for smooth integration of systems, making it easier to share information and capabilities.

One of the crucial elements of web services is their use of common methods like HTTP and XML to promote interaction. This standardization ensures that various systems can understand and connect with each other successfully. Internet services can be classified right into 2 primary types: SOAP (Simple Item Accessibility Protocol) and Remainder (Representational State Transfer).

SOAP is a protocol that utilizes XML for message exchange, while REST depends on standard HTTP techniques like obtain, UPLOAD, PUT, and erase. Both have their staminas and are utilized in different scenarios based upon needs.

Key Principles and Technologies



Checking out the fundamental principles and modern technologies of web services is important for understanding their performance and application in modern systems. When delving right into the vital principles and technologies of web solutions, you unlock to a globe of interconnected possibilities. Below are some essential elements to realize:

- ** SOAP (Simple Things Gain Access To Protocol) **: This protocol defines the framework of messages traded in between web solutions.
- ** WSDL (Web Solutions Summary Language) **: WSDL is made use of to define the functionalities offered by an internet service.
- ** REST (Representational State Transfer) **: An architectural style that utilizes typical HTTP approaches for communication between clients and web servers.
- ** XML (Extensible Markup Language) **: XML plays a vital function in information exchange between internet solutions as a result of its convenience and readability.

Understanding these core principles and technologies will certainly lay a strong structure for your journey right into the realm of web services.

Best Practices for Implementation



To guarantee effective application of internet services, prioritize adherence to best methods. Begin by thoroughly documenting your internet solution APIs, including clear descriptions of endpoints, parameters, and anticipated reactions. Constant calling conventions and versioning of APIs are important for maintainability. When designing search engine positioning seo , adhere to the concepts of remainder to develop a scalable and versatile architecture. Execute correct verification and permission systems to safeguard your solutions, such as OAuth or API secrets.

website development firm is important in making sure the integrity of your web solutions. Establish thorough test cases that cover different circumstances, including positive and unfavorable testing. Constant integration and automated screening can aid catch issues early in the development process. Screen your web services in real-time to identify performance bottlenecks and possible failings. Logging and error handling are necessary for diagnosing problems and troubleshooting issues successfully.



Last but not least, take into consideration the scalability of your internet services deliberately for future development. Apply caching devices and tons balancing to handle increased web traffic. Consistently testimonial and enhance your code for efficiency. By following these ideal practices, you can enhance the execution of internet services and ensure their success.

Final thought

Congratulations! You've simply unlocked the key to grasping internet services. By understanding the crucial ideas and technologies, and applying ideal practices, you're well on your way to becoming a web services specialist.

Keep checking out and try out what you have actually learned to continue expanding your expertise and abilities in this exciting field.

The globe of web services is currently at your fingertips, prepared for you to explore and overcome. Take pleasure in the journey!